Section 250-RICR-60-00-1.7 - Violations
A. Any violation pursuant to the provisions of R.I. Gen. Laws Title 20 and the Rules and Regulations herein, either by a permittee or a sub-permittee working under said permittee may be cause for imposing penalties in accordance with the provisions of the above-mentioned statute, removal of wild animals in their possession as well as revocation of existing wildlife rehabilitation permit(s) of both the sub-permittee and responsible permittee.
B. Special Purpose Scientific Collector Permits for Wildlife Rehabilitation may be terminated by the Director for any of the following reasons:
1. The Wildlife Rehabilitator has ceased to meet appropriate eligibility requirements for appointment as set forth in these Regulations.
2. The Wildlife Rehabilitator has failed to perform duties as provided for or required in these Regulations.
3. The Level 1 Apprentice Wildlife Rehabilitator or sub-permittee does not meet criteria on evaluation form and/or is no longer endorsed by their designated sponsors.
4. The Wildlife Rehabilitator has ceased to have an approved wildlife rehabilitation facility available for permittee's use.
a. The loss of, or inability to obtain veterinary cooperation from a Rhode Island licensed veterinarian as required.
